mobileYouth Workout Schedule 2008

Posted on 28 April 2008 by Graham Brown

AddThis Feed Button Bookmark and Share

Admin

Venue: The Charing Cross Guoman Hotel (formerly known as the Thistle Hotel)

Dress Code: Strictly Business Casual (no ties allowed!)

Location: Charing Cross, London W1

Time & Date: 0845-1700 Friday 2nd May

Agenda

0845: START: Registration & Coffee

0915: Opening Presentation by Graham Brown, Author of mobileYouth on key data, trends, statistics & insights on the mobile youth market

1000: Panel Discussion on Youth Marketing led by Mark Linder, Global Client Leader WPP with ~
* Rhys McLachlan, Head of Broadcast Development, Mediacom
* Helen Keegan, Managing Director, Beep Marketing
* Damien Saunders, Head of Music, Vodafone
* Ed Homes, Account Director, Haygarth

1040: Networking Coffee

1100: Keynote Presentation on Youth Personalization & Avatars by Tal Dagan, Comverse

1120: Case Study Presentation on Moderating Youth Communities by Dominic Sparkes, CEO Tempero

1130: Panel Discussion on Web 2.0 & Social Networks led by Ged Carroll from Waggener Edstrom with ~
* Sunil Gunderia, VP Disney
* Dominic Sparkes, CEO Tempero
* Zvika Delman, Marketing Director, Comverse
* Jeff Talyor, Marketing Director, 3

1200: Roundtable Discussion

1300: Lunch

1400: Panel Discussion on Profiling Young Consumers for Marketing and Product Development chaired by Nick Wiggin from WhoHow with ~
* Jack Wallington, Prog Manager of IAB
* Matthew Snyder, CEO of ADO Strategies
* David Murphy, Editor Mobile Marketing Magazine

1450: Case Study Presentation on Youth & Entertainment by Louis Ford from Tanla Mobile

1500: Case Study Presentation on Infotainment driving ARPU by Colin Campbell, Handmark

1510: Panel Discussion on Youth & Entertainment Chaired by Monty Munford from Monty’s Gaming Outlook with ~
* Marc Humphrey, Senior Director Sony BMG
* Gunnar Larsen, Director, RealNetworks
* Amelia Gammon, Director, Universal
* Neal Holroyd, Head of Games, Orange
* Richard Morris, Head of Video, Player X
* Louis Ford, Head of Sales, Tanla Mobile

1550: Networking Coffee

1610: Case Study Presentation on Safeguarding Young Consumers by Simeon Coney, VP Adaptive Mobile1630: Youth Panel Session - “My Operator Looks After Me” (House Motion) Chaired by Graham Brown, Author mobileYouth with ~
* Raimund Schmolze, VP, T-Mobile
* Glyn Povah, Head of Content Marketing, O2
* Damien Saunders, Snr Manager, Vodafone
* Students from Huron University

1700: END

Graham Brown and Josh Dhaliwal founded mobileYouth in 2001 to give technology, brands and marketing professionals the tools to better understand young consumers, incorporate youth into their product development, build dialogue, develop trust and establish ethical marketing policies. We currently serve over 300 clients in 60 countries worldwide (names such as Nokia, Apple, Telenor, Vodafone, MTN, MTV, BBC and the UK government). mobileYouth (R) and "Mobile Youth" (R) are registered trademarks of W2F Limited.
